Study Details
Endometriosis is a common gynecological disorder associated with chronic pelvic pain and infertility, which affects women of reproductive age worldwide. This study aims to investigate the expression patterns of specific molecules in tissue specimens obtained from patients with endometriosis. The investigators will compare the expression levels of these molecules between endometriotic lesions and normal tissue. The primary objective of this study is to elucidate the potential roles of these molecules in the pathogenesis of endometriosis.
